Rabid raccoon identified in Maplewood; vaccinate your pets

MAPLEWOOD, NJ — St. Hubert’s Animal Control captured a young male raccoon on June 8 and identified that it was infected with rabies virus, according to a June 11 press release from the Maplewood Health Department. TC blames county for delay on pedestrian safety project

MAPLEWOOD, NJ — The Maplewood Township Committee alleged at their June 6 meeting that Essex County has not upheld its promise of a joint-project with the town to redesign the intersections where Baker Street and Tuscan Road meet Valley Street, a county road.
